Course Description

Focuses on technical/analytical skills for smart systems that support sustainability. Learners examine environmental impact of data infrastructures and design greener digital solutions using IoT, smart energy systems and green coding to reduce resource use and improve environmental performance across cities, utilities and industry.

Learning Outcomes

Explain how IoT, smart grids and sensors support sustainability; analyse environmental impact of data centres and cloud; apply energy-efficient design in ICT; assess how digital tools optimise energy/water/waste; communicate ethical/responsible digital practices for sustainability.

Hard Skills

Configure/interpret data from sensor systems; Reduce energy consumption of HW/SW; Understand components of smart energy/transport/urban systems; Use digital tools to model/simulate/optimise infrastructure

Soft Skills

Environmental problem-solving; Critical analysis; Team collaboration; Ethical awareness in smart systems deployment
